12/// HQC-specific error types
13///
14/// This enum represents all possible errors that can occur during HQC operations.
15/// Each variant includes context about when the error occurs and how to resolve it.
16#[derive(Debug, Clone, PartialEq, Eq)]
17pub enum HqcError {
18 /// Invalid key size
19 ///
20 /// **When it occurs:** A key (public or secret) has an incorrect size for the HQC parameter set.
21 /// **Cause:** The key data provided doesn't match the expected size for the algorithm variant (HQC-128, HQC-192, or HQC-256).
22 /// **Resolution:** Ensure the key size matches the parameter set: HQC-128 (2249 bytes public, 2289 bytes secret),
23 /// HQC-192 (4522 bytes public, 4562 bytes secret), or HQC-256 (7245 bytes public, 7285 bytes secret).
24 InvalidKeySize { expected: usize, actual: usize },
25
26 /// Invalid ciphertext size
27 ///
28 /// **When it occurs:** A ciphertext has an incorrect size for the HQC parameter set.
29 /// **Cause:** The ciphertext data doesn't match the expected size for decapsulation.
30 /// **Resolution:** Ensure the ciphertext was generated for the same HQC parameter set and hasn't been corrupted.
31 InvalidCiphertextSize { expected: usize, actual: usize },
32
33 /// Invalid public key size
34 ///
35 /// **When it occurs:** A public key has an incorrect size.
36 /// **Cause:** The public key data doesn't match the expected size for the HQC parameter set.
37 /// **Resolution:** Verify the public key was generated or serialized correctly for the intended parameter set.
38 InvalidPublicKeySize { expected: usize, actual: usize },
39
40 /// Invalid secret key size
41 ///
42 /// **When it occurs:** A secret key has an incorrect size.
43 /// **Cause:** The secret key data doesn't match the expected size for the HQC parameter set.
44 /// **Resolution:** Verify the secret key was generated or deserialized correctly for the intended parameter set.
45 InvalidSecretKeySize { expected: usize, actual: usize },
46
47 /// Decryption failed
48 ///
49 /// **When it occurs:** Decapsulation fails to recover the shared secret.
50 /// **Cause:** The ciphertext may be corrupted, the secret key may be incorrect, or the ciphertext was generated with a different public key.
51 /// **Resolution:** Verify the ciphertext and secret key are valid and correspond to each other.
52 DecryptionFailed,
53
54 /// Invalid size
55 ///
56 /// **When it occurs:** A size parameter is invalid or out of bounds.
57 /// **Cause:** A size value doesn't meet the requirements for the operation.
58 /// **Resolution:** Check that all size parameters are within valid ranges for the HQC parameter set.
59 InvalidSize,
60
61 /// Encryption failed
62 ///
63 /// **When it occurs:** Encapsulation fails to generate a valid ciphertext.
64 /// **Cause:** Random number generation may have failed, or internal computation encountered an error.
65 /// **Resolution:** Ensure a secure random number generator is available and functioning correctly.
66 EncryptionFailed,
67
68 /// Key generation failed
69 ///
70 /// **When it occurs:** Key pair generation fails.
71 /// **Cause:** Random number generation may have failed, or internal computation encountered an error.
72 /// **Resolution:** Ensure a secure random number generator is available and functioning correctly.
73 KeyGenerationFailed,
74
75 /// Random number generation failed
76 ///
77 /// **When it occurs:** The random number generator fails to produce random bytes.
78 /// **Cause:** The underlying RNG implementation encountered an error or is unavailable.
79 /// **Resolution:** Check RNG initialization and ensure a secure random source is available.
80 RandomGenerationFailed,
81
82 /// Internal error
83 ///
84 /// **When it occurs:** An unexpected internal error occurs during HQC operations.
85 /// **Cause:** This typically indicates a bug in the implementation or corrupted internal state.
86 /// **Resolution:** Report this error as it may indicate a software bug. Check inputs and system state.
87 InternalError,
88
89 /// Not implemented
90 ///
91 /// **When it occurs:** A requested feature or operation is not yet implemented.
92 /// **Cause:** The operation is not available in the current implementation.
93 /// **Resolution:** Check if an alternative approach is available, or wait for the feature to be implemented.
94 NotImplemented,
95
96 /// Invalid parameter
97 ///
98 /// **When it occurs:** A parameter value is invalid for the operation.
99 /// **Cause:** A parameter doesn't meet the requirements or constraints for the HQC operation.
100 /// **Resolution:** Verify all parameters are within valid ranges and meet the algorithm requirements.
101 InvalidParameter,
102
103 /// Memory allocation failed
104 ///
105 /// **When it occurs:** Dynamic memory allocation fails during an operation.
106 /// **Cause:** Insufficient memory is available, or allocation is not supported in the current environment.
107 /// **Resolution:** Ensure sufficient memory is available, or use a no_std-compatible configuration.
108 AllocationFailed,
109
110 /// Hash function error
111 ///
112 /// **When it occurs:** A hash function operation fails.
113 /// **Cause:** The underlying hash implementation encountered an error.
114 /// **Resolution:** Check that the hash function implementation is properly initialized and functioning.
115 HashError,
116
117 /// BCH code error
118 ///
119 /// **When it occurs:** BCH (Bose-Chaudhuri-Hocquenghem) code operations fail.
120 /// **Cause:** Error correction code computation encountered an error, possibly due to corrupted data.
121 /// **Resolution:** Verify input data integrity and that error correction parameters are correct.
122 BchError,
123
124 /// Polynomial operation error
125 ///
126 /// **When it occurs:** Polynomial arithmetic operations fail.
127 /// **Cause:** Polynomial computation encountered an error, possibly due to invalid coefficients or degree.
128 /// **Resolution:** Verify polynomial inputs are valid and within expected ranges.
129 PolynomialError,
130
131 /// Encoding error
132 ///
133 /// **When it occurs:** Encoding operations fail.
134 /// **Cause:** Data encoding encountered an error, possibly due to invalid input format.
135 /// **Resolution:** Verify input data format and encoding parameters are correct.
136 EncodingError,
137
138 /// Verification error
139 ///
140 /// **When it occurs:** Verification operations fail.
141 /// **Cause:** Data verification failed, indicating the data may be corrupted or invalid.
142 /// **Resolution:** Verify input data integrity and that verification parameters are correct.
143 VerificationError,
144
145 /// Invalid weight
146 ///
147 /// **When it occurs:** A polynomial weight is invalid for the operation.
148 /// **Cause:** The weight parameter doesn't meet the requirements for the HQC parameter set.
149 /// **Resolution:** Ensure the weight is within valid ranges: HQC-128 (66), HQC-192 (103), or HQC-256 (134).
150 InvalidWeight,
151
152 /// Allocation required (for no_std environments)
153 ///
154 /// **When it occurs:** An operation requires dynamic allocation but the `alloc` feature is not enabled.
155 /// **Cause:** The operation needs heap allocation but the crate is compiled in `no_std` mode without `alloc`.
156 /// **Resolution:** Enable the `alloc` feature or use an alternative approach that doesn't require allocation.
157 AllocRequired,
158}
